At the vast plaza in the city's center rose the largest earthwork in the Americas, the 100-foot Monks Mound.Īround the great urban center, farmers grew crops to feed the city-dwellers, who included not only government officials and religious leaders but also skilled tradesworkers, artisans and even astronomers. Many were massive, square-bottomed, flat-topped pyramids - great pedestals atop which civic leaders lived. An Indian trader paddling down the Mississippi River during the city's heyday between 10 couldn't have missed it.Ĭahokia was the largest city ever built north of Mexico before Columbus and boasted 120 earthen mounds. North America was dotted in those days with villages, strung together by a loose web of commerce. Welcome to the city of Cahokia, population 15,000. Image courtesy of Cahokia Mounds State Historic Site The ancient civilization's massive remains stand as one of the best-kept archaeological secrets in the country. and withered away about a century before Columbus reached America. This culture arose in the Mississippi Valley, in what is now Illinois, about 700 A.D. These weren't the Maya or Aztecs of Mexico. Imagine an ancient Native American settlement where people built pyramids, designed solar observatories and, we must report, practiced human sacrifice.
